Mileage tracker apps for Android, iPhone & Blackberry

With the advent of smartphones being mainstream and real estate professionals working while mobile, the days of writing down mileage are now behind us. Anyone who has worked in the real estate industry for more than five seconds knows the critical importance and financial benefit of tracking mileage but it’s an annoying task for many.

In steps smartphone mileage trackers. Equipped with GPS, several apps can simply read your mileage, document, track it and even graph it for you simply by pushing one button when you start driving and one when you stop. Think of it as a stopwatch. Below are several apps for the three largest operating systems in use in the mobile world right now:
